Burnaby 6-Day Volunteers Wanted

December 2, 2007 – I’m sure everyone is aware of the Burnaby Six Day running from December 31 to January 5 this year. Because it’s at a time of year when the holiday season is just wrapping up, back to school is going on, and due to the number of days we’re in action, any volunteer assistance we can muster is going to make a difference in putting on a great event.

Throughout the six days we’re offering 20+ hours of racing and 100 races (plus heats). If you can help for one evening, that’s great. More than one even greater! Take a look at the schedule and see what works for you. I’ll be maintaining and distributing a schedule to keep things sorted.

Volunteers eat and hydrate (within limits) for free. You also get a red BVC “STAFF” T-shirt. Be the first on your block!

Pre-Event Race package preparation:
– Race numbers, pins, swag into bags to ease sign-in.
– Purse envelope stuffing: Cash etc. into envelopes and labelled by event.
– Tile lifting party: We need to clear the corners to create a warm up lane inside the cote. Some Saturday soon!
– Warm up lane painting party: Grippy paint on that slick cement… once the tiles are up.

Set-up/Tear Down December 31 – Setup from 5:00 – 7:00PM. Many hands make light work:– Nets to take down, tables to setup, etc. January 5, 9:30PM
– Tear down. Set-up but backwards! Takes an hour.
NOTE: We stay set up the whole week. No futzing around from night to night.

For each session:
Registration:
– Verifying entries in the laptop, getting racers their numbers, etc.
– Lap Counter/Bell Ringer. Special requirement: Ability to add and subtract. 😉
– Holders: For sprint sessions. If you’ll be around let me know and we can call you specifically.
– Whip: Move through the in-field prompting riders to get ready for the next event. Valuable role!
– First Aid attendant: Just in case.
– Points counters: Keeping track of points and finishers is critical and “extra eyes” always help.
– Results/schedule/start list runner: Post race materials to the whiteboard for racers to reference.
– Results/schedules/start list entry: We’ve got two…a third would be great backup. Must know Excel. Mail me!
– Merchandise: Help promote the BV by selling our spiffy gear. We’re working at getting a Visa terminal!
– Concession: We’re planning to have hot food like last year. Help keep it going!
– Neutral Mechanic: Wheel swaps for pro/elite, etc.
– Announcing: Groupo compacto? Someone else must have a phrase they want to use?
– Reporters/photo/videographers: If you’re shooting or want to write a report, let me know and we’ll check with you for content we can post.

That’s a big list but at every event we see too few people doing too many things. This leads to errors and delays, so grabbing hold of something definitely makes a difference in putting on an enjoyable event for everyone.
